FDR Go PLUS’s Onboard Technology:
At the heart of the system is the intelligent onboard technologist console, powered by Dynamic Visualization™ image processing. This advanced software automatically identifies the region of interest within the frame and applies the optimal processing parameters across the entire exposure field. The result is consistently exceptional imagery featuring higher detail and contrast levels. This automated optimization provides improved window and leveling capabilities for diagnosis in PACS, allowing radiologists to interpret scans with greater speed and accuracy.
- High-Definition Imaging with Lower Doses: The system utilizes patented Irradiated Side Sampling (ISS) technology. This revolutionary design positions capture electronics at the patient side of the capture layers—where data signals are strongest and sharpest. This yields exceptional detail and image quality while significantly improving dose efficiency compared to conventional circuitry designs.
- Advanced Infection Control: To support hospital hygiene protocols, the FDR D-EVO III & II detectors feature Fujifilm’s exclusive Hydro AG antibacterial coating. This specialized surface assists in preventing the spread of bacteria, adding an extra layer of safety for both patients and staff.
- Enhanced Durability and Mobility: The FDR D-EVO III detectors utilize a revolutionary glass-free design. This makes the detectors ultra-lightweight for easier handling by technicians and increases durability against drops and impacts, ensuring reliable performance in fast-paced medical settings.
- Intelligent Workflow Automation: With Dynamic Visualization™, the system reduces the need for manual adjustments and retakes. The technology adapts to the specific exam conditions, ensuring high-quality outputs that support immediate clinical decision-making.

Virtual Grid Technology:
Intelligent processing simulates grid use, improving contrast and clarity while reducing radiation dose by up to 50% for grid-free acquisitions.
- Automatic Anatomy Recognition: Intuitively identifies anatomical characteristics and scatter effect to precisely tune contrast and noise control for optimal image quality
- Eliminates Grid-Related Complications: Prevents retakes caused by physical grid misalignment and improper source-to-image distance (SID), streamlining your workflow
- Fully Customizable: Adjust grid characteristics including grid lines, density, and interspacing material to match your specific imaging requirements
- Versatile Application: Can be applied across all body parts including chest, abdomen, head, spine, pelvis, and upper and lower extremities
- Ideal for Portable Exams: Simplifies acquisition and positioning during bedside imaging, eliminating the need to transport and align physical grids
- Multi-Frequency Processing (MFP): Enhances edge definition and gray scale processing across multiple frequencies, improving visibility of varying tissue densities and foreign structures. Particularly valuable for spine, skull, and orthopedic hardware imaging.
- Flexible Noise Control (FNC): Selectively reduces image noise while preserving critical sharpness and detail. Optimized for challenging views including pediatric imaging, lumbar spine, and abdominal studies.
- Grid Pattern Removal (GPR): Automatically eliminates moiré artifacts caused by physical anti-scatter grids, ensuring cleaner, more accurate images.
